A girl has died and another person has been injured in a pickup van accident on the Koldanda-Tharpu inner road section in Koldanda, Myagde Rural Municipality-4 of the district.

The deceased has been identified as Koiska Gharti, 13, daughter of Buddhi Bahadur Gharti, a resident of Myagde-4 Koldanda, police said.

At around 7:30 am on Sunday, the driver of a pickup truck (Ga 3 Cha 5835) coming from Koldanda towards Tharpu lost control and fell about 20 meters off the road, police said.

Koiska, who was injured in the accident, suffered serious head injuries and was taken to the Provincial Hospital in Damauli for treatment. At around 8:40 am, doctors at the hospital declared her dead, according to Tanahun police.

Similarly, 15-year-old Dipsan Gharti of the same place sustained injuries to his chest and groin. His condition is said to be moderate and he is undergoing treatment. Three people, including the driver, were in the van at the time of the accident.
